عام غلطی:
Learners sometimes think 'headlong' just means 'head first'. In this meaning, it focuses on fast and careless action, often in abstract situations like projects, relationships, or decisions. Also, learners may confuse it with 'headstrong', which means stubborn, not fast or careless.

عام غلطی:
Learners may overuse 'headlong' before every fast action. It usually describes a strong, often negative kind of speed, especially in big changes or risky plans, not simple things like 'a headlong walk to school'.

عام غلطی:
Learners sometimes use 'headlong' instead of 'headfirst' in all cases. 'Headlong' often suggests a sudden or uncontrolled movement, especially in falls, while 'headfirst' can also describe careful or intentional movement (for example, diving into a pool).

عام غلطی:
Learners may not see a difference between this physical meaning and the more abstract, 'reckless' meaning. When it describes a physical fall or movement, there is usually a clear body action like 'fall', 'plunge', or 'tumble' nearby.
